Baking stones!
A good and relatively CHEAP method of obtaining a baking
stone is to go to a local
CERAMIC SHOP. Purchase a NEW KILN SHELF.
I emphasize NEW. You don't want a used shelf, using a shelf
which has been used in firing pottery can
absorb various and sundry items , in gaseous forms, from the
glazes used on the pottery. These chemicals can be outgassed
to the food if they are present.
Again, NEW SHELVES ONLY.
That is what I use and I have had very good results, as good
as the expensive baking stones which are available at the
locas kitchen supply stored in Cincinnati.
